Understanding the Technology Behind the Innovation
At its core, this new system is built on two important blockchain standards: ERC-4337 smart accounts and ERC-7710 delegations, both integrated through MetaMask’s Smart Accounts Kit. Think of these as advanced protocols that create a sophisticated permission system for your cryptocurrency wallet. Instead of traditional wallets where you either have full access or no access at all, these smart accounts work more like modern business systems where you can assign different levels of authority to different people or, in this case, AI agents. The technology allows users to keep complete ownership of their private keys – essentially the master passwords to their cryptocurrency holdings – while still enabling AI agents like CoinFello to perform specific tasks on their behalf. This is revolutionary because in the past, allowing automated systems to interact with your blockchain assets meant giving them full access, which posed significant security risks. Now, users can maintain complete control while still benefiting from the efficiency and capabilities of AI-powered transaction management.
Security-First Approach in an AI-Driven World
The CoinFello system operates on what’s known as a “least-privilege model,” a concept borrowed from traditional cybersecurity practices. This principle means that any AI agent or automated system is given only the minimum level of access necessary to perform its designated tasks – nothing more. When a user wants to make a transaction, they can simply describe what they want to do in plain English, and CoinFello’s AI translates that request into the appropriate blockchain commands. However, before anything actually happens, the system validates the transaction to ensure it matches what the user intended and falls within the permissions they’ve granted. This extra layer of verification acts as a safety net, protecting users from potential errors or malicious activities. The beauty of this approach is that users never need to share their private keys or sensitive API credentials with the AI system, dramatically reducing the risk of theft or unauthorized access that has plagued the cryptocurrency industry.

Rapid Adoption and Practical Applications
The launch of CoinFello’s OpenClaw skill comes at a time when the broader OpenClaw ecosystem is experiencing explosive growth. The numbers tell a compelling story: the platform has garnered over 150,000 stars on GitHub, the popular code-sharing platform used by developers worldwide, along with 22,000 forks, which indicates that thousands of developers are actively building upon and experimenting with the technology. Perhaps most impressively, the platform has seen more than 416,000 downloads through npm, a package manager for JavaScript, in just the past month alone. This level of adoption suggests strong developer interest and confidence in the technology. As for what users can actually do with these AI-powered Moltbots, the possibilities are extensive and practical. Through simple, conversational commands, users can instruct the bots to perform a wide range of blockchain operations: swapping one cryptocurrency for another (ERC-20 token swaps), moving assets between different blockchain networks (cross-chain bridging), buying, selling, or interacting with NFTs (non-fungible tokens), participating in staking programs to earn rewards, engaging in lending protocols, automatically rebalancing investment portfolios, and executing sophisticated multi-step trading strategies that would normally require constant monitoring and manual intervention. The user experience is designed to be as simple as having a conversation – no need to understand complex blockchain commands or technical jargon.
Open Development and Future Directions
CoinFello has made a strategic decision to release the OpenClaw skill under the MIT license, one of the most permissive open-source licenses available. This means that developers around the world are free to use, modify, and build upon the technology without restrictive licensing fees or complicated legal requirements. The skill is designed to work seamlessly with the Agent Skills specification, operates within OpenClaw environments, and is compatible with Claude Code, expanding its potential use cases and developer appeal. Looking ahead, CoinFello has outlined an ambitious roadmap for future development. The company plans to expand the permission frameworks even further, potentially allowing for even more nuanced control over what AI agents can and cannot do. Additionally, deeper integration with MetaMask’s Smart Accounts Kit is on the horizon, which could unlock additional features and capabilities. Importantly, CoinFello emphasizes that while the initial implementation works specifically with Moltbots, the underlying technology allows for delegation of permissions to any compatible blockchain agent, making this a potentially industry-wide solution rather than a proprietary system.
